1. Crock Pot Pulled Pork Sliders
For an easy yet crowd-pleasing New Year’s dish, look no further than these slow-cooked pulled pork sliders.
Perfect for a stress-free celebration, this recipe will have you using your crock pot to tenderize pork shoulder to perfection.
The slow cooking process allows the flavors of smoky barbecue sauce, tangy apple cider vinegar, and a dash of brown sugar to infuse into the meat, creating a melt-in-your-mouth experience.
The beauty of this dish is in its versatility.
You can serve it on soft slider buns with a side of homemade coleslaw, or keep it simple with a dollop of extra sauce and pickles.
Add a few pickled jalapeños for a touch of heat, and you’re all set for the festivities.
This is a great option for parties or gatherings, as it requires minimal prep and keeps everyone happily fed without constant attention.
Set it and forget it while you focus on ringing in the New Year!

13. Crock Pot BBQ Ribs
For a show-stopping New Year’s Eve dish, these Crock Pot BBQ Ribs will steal the spotlight.
Cooking low and slow in your crock pot results in melt-in-your-mouth, fall-off-the-bone tender ribs that are smothered in a tangy and sweet barbecue sauce.
The secret to great ribs is the slow cooking process, which allows the flavors to develop deeply and evenly throughout the meat.
Before cooking, coat the ribs with your favorite dry rub—paprika, brown sugar, garlic powder, and a hint of cayenne for a perfect balance of sweetness and heat.
Then, let them cook in the crock pot with a little extra barbecue sauce to create a sticky, flavorful glaze.
Serve the ribs with classic sides like coleslaw, cornbread, or baked beans for a true Southern-inspired feast.
These ribs are perfect for feeding a crowd during your New Year’s celebration, and they can be prepped ahead of time and reheated in the crock pot so you can enjoy the party without being stuck in the kitchen.

18. Crock Pot Pork Carnitas Tacos
These Crock Pot Pork Carnitas are the perfect choice for a flavorful and easy-to-prepare meal during your New Year’s celebration.
The pork shoulder is slow-cooked in a mix of citrus, garlic, cumin, and chili powder, resulting in tender, juicy meat that’s bursting with flavor.
As the pork cooks, it soaks up the spices and citrus juices, transforming into mouth-watering carnitas that are perfect for tacos, burritos, or even bowls.
Once the pork is cooked, shred it with a fork, and serve with your favorite taco toppings—think cilantro, onions, lime wedges, and a dollop of salsa or guacamole.
For a bit of extra crunch, you can also crisp up the shredded pork in a skillet before serving.
The beauty of this recipe is that it can be made ahead and kept warm in the crock pot, making it ideal for a laid-back New Year’s party or taco bar.
These pork carnitas are guaranteed to be a hit with your guests, offering a flavorful and customizable dish that’s sure to become a favorite.

19. Crock Pot New Year’s Day Ham with Pineapple
Kick off the New Year with this sweet and savory Crock Pot Ham with Pineapple, a perfect dish for both dinner and brunch.
This recipe takes a bone-in or spiral ham and slow-cooks it with a tangy, syrupy glaze made from pineapple juice, brown sugar, Dijon mustard, and a touch of cloves.
As the ham cooks, it absorbs the sweet and spicy flavors from the glaze, becoming incredibly juicy and tender.
For the ultimate presentation, you can add fresh pineapple slices or chunks to the crock pot during the last hour of cooking.
The fruit caramelizes in the glaze, adding a vibrant touch and enhancing the flavors of the ham.
Serve this on its own, or pair it with classic sides like mashed potatoes, roasted vegetables, or a crisp green salad.
This dish is ideal for New Year’s Day or any celebratory meal, and it’s perfect for feeding a crowd with minimal effort.
Just set it and forget it, and you’ll have a stunning centerpiece for your meal.
